Per Adrian Mertens at PIC International 2023 Brussels from the SilOriX presentation:

1:16 Planning to produce in mass. We’re not talking hundreds, we’re talking millions of devices.
1:55 Organic electro-optic polymer can be dissolved. It’s a solution process, at least as scalable as silicon foundry processes.
3:50 Can be produced with completely standard foundry processes. 100% backend applied using heat and applied voltage, then allowed to cool while voltage is still applied.
4:35 Polling process, which can also be done on the wafer level
6:00 Long-term stable. 50% in the room raise doubts about stability as soon as they hear “polymer”. Testing at 130 degrees C for 6-7000 hours.
9:13 In a nutshell, totally scalable backend applied, doesn’t need changes in the foundry.
130 GBd PAM-4 sub-V driverless signal
800G devices are ready for testing, and then later integration.
